struct xmlShellCtxt

struct xmlShellCtxt {
    char *filename;
    xmlDocPtr doc;
    xmlNodePtr node;
    xmlXPathContextPtr pctxt;
    int loaded;
    FILE *output;
    xmlShellReadlineFunc input;
};

A debugging shell context. TODO: add the defined function tables.

xmlShellList ()

int         xmlShellList                    (xmlShellCtxtPtr ctxt,
                                             char *arg,
                                             xmlNodePtr node,
                                             xmlNodePtr node2);

Implements the XML shell function "ls" Does an Unix like listing of the given node (like a directory)

xmlShellValidate ()

int         xmlShellValidate                (xmlShellCtxtPtr ctxt,
                                             char *dtd,
                                             xmlNodePtr node,
                                             xmlNodePtr node2);

Implements the XML shell function "validate" Validate the document, if a DTD path is provided, then the validation is done against the given DTD.

xmlShellDu ()

int         xmlShellDu                      (xmlShellCtxtPtr ctxt,
                                             char *arg,
                                             xmlNodePtr tree,
                                             xmlNodePtr node2);

Implements the XML shell function "du" show the structure of the subtree under node tree If tree is null, the command works on the current node.

xmlShellPwd ()

int         xmlShellPwd                     (xmlShellCtxtPtr ctxt,
                                             char *buffer,
                                             xmlNodePtr node,
                                             xmlNodePtr node2);

Implements the XML shell function "pwd" Show the full path from the root to the node, if needed building thumblers when similar elements exists at a given ancestor level. The output is compatible with XPath commands.

xmlShell ()

void        xmlShell                        (xmlDocPtr doc,
                                             char *filename,
                                             xmlShellReadlineFunc input,
                                             FILE *output);

Implements the XML shell This allow to load, validate, view, modify and save a document using a environment similar to a UNIX commandline.
